Output 740a21d77be33909793f21ef229fa5be4103d2f7d2e98bc123381efb45c954cc:1

value
75906860
script pubkey
OP_0 OP_PUSHBYTES_20 324e0919363bbddf347f76101b93ee2a68328e06
address
bc1qxf8qjxfk8w7a7drlwcgphylw9f5r9rsxxx7dcz
transaction
740a21d77be33909793f21ef229fa5be4103d2f7d2e98bc123381efb45c954cc
confirmations
123382
spent
true